Output 59b95f995e0033f20472726a7bd70a8dabcad478f74bae215a781e2e7b96b5f5:0
- value
- 50324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9141feee92f35b5925ad0ca04c102841c387b46e OP_EQUAL
- address
- 3Ew4xq5GhkvynGz4epY4gpeKbYDKodvbUL
- transaction
- 59b95f995e0033f20472726a7bd70a8dabcad478f74bae215a781e2e7b96b5f5
- confirmations
- 156083
- spent
- true